I was surprised to see the package arrive ahead of schedule. The case appears to be sturdy and looks good. The only thing that I did not like was receiving lenses that were not as described 18mm and 9mm, which was a bummer since I got the telescope along with 9mm. I also noticed that the filter cases are scratched up ( no big deal). However, the filters are just as bad. I think I obtained Several of the colored filters also are not in accordance with the description. When I test out the units over the weekend, I will update my review. As a result of careful reading, I can confirm that the item description with regard to the focal lens is incorrect and that you actually receive 6mm, 9mm, 13mm, 18mm and 32mm (see picture). Aside from this minor complaint, I have no other issues. Observe the sky and enjoy it.
